United Cerebral Palsy of Georgia is seeking a Senior Planner based in Berkshire, UK. The role focuses on leading the planning capability, managing the Integrated Master Schedule (IMS), and supporting task management efforts.
Ideal candidates should possess extensive planning experience and expertise in Earned Value Management (EVM) alongside strong communication skills to effectively engage with stakeholders.
